Get started17 Fieldfare Way is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Telford (TF4 3TH). It has a recorded floor area of 55 m² (around 592 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a C (score 73). When first surveyed in April 2012 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 4.9%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£184,000 is 47.2%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£211/sq ft) was about 119.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 8 years ago, in March 2018.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
